THE ROLE OF ETHICAL AND AESTHETIC CATEGORIES IN THE DEVELOPMENT OF INTELLECT (on the еxample of the philosophical views of Abu Hamid al-Ghazali and Immanuel Kant)

Abstract

This article provides a philosophical analysis of Immanuel Kant's ethical and aesthetic views. Researching and understanding the events and processes, laws, contradictions, and trends in the development of cultural existence provides a profound understanding of the essence of human morality.
